This year's Annual General Assembly will take place on 26-27 November 2024, under the theme "Financing Food Systems Transformation and Rural Revitalization: Opportunities and Challenges". We will examine how the international community is rethinking the use of limited Official Development Assistance (ODA) donor resources in food and nutrition. This includes exploring innovative financing, better coordination of donor approaches, and stronger harmonization of stakeholder engagement.
